    The Acer One S1001-19P0 laptop is an old Win-10 10.1 inch laptop that Acer has stopped support for, I suggest that you go into its Win-10 OS Device Manager and uninstall all the touchpad compliant devices and then reboot the laptop, as afterwards the touchpad should work, if it doesn't then you either have a faulty touchpad cable or a touchpad that need inspecting or replacing.     If your cursor will not move or your touchpad is not working at all:-Remove connected devices - Remove all devices that are connected to the system except for the power cord. This includes external keyboard, mouse, flash drives, hard drives and other peripherals.

    Enable/disable your touchpad - Many systems allow you to turn the touchpad On or Off by pressing a key combination. On most models it is FN + F7 or FN + F2, but could also be a different function key. The touchpad function key will be labeled with one of the images below.

    Restart your computer - Restarting your system may help your touchpad start responding again.

    Reset BIOS or UEFI to default settings - Some systems have touchpad settings in the BIOS/UEFI.Reinstall touchpad drivers - Missing or incorrect drivers may cause your touchpad to not work properly. You can try downloading and installing the latest driver from our Acer Drivers and Manuals page.

    You may need to attach an external mouse to complete this process.

    Restore Windows- Newer versions of Windows allow you to restore your operating system without losing your personal data. Make sure you select the option to Keep my files.

    If you can move your cursor but are having problems with cursor speed, erratic behavior or tapping and clicking. Adjust touchpad sensitivity - If your cursor is moving too fast or too slow, you can try changing your touchpad sensitivity.

    Disable tap to click - Accidentally making contact with the touchpad when typing can cause the cursor to jump around or leave the window.
